import cv2 # Input values image_path = 'tmp/extracted_frame.png' # Replace with your PNG file output_path = 'frame_with_box_normalized.png' bbox = (480, 598, 608, 815) # Load the image image = cv2.imread(image_path) if image is None: raise IOError(f"Could not load image: {image_path}") img_height, img_width = image.shape[:2] y_min = int(bbox[0] / 1000.0 * img_height) x_min = int(bbox[1] / 1000.0 * img_width) y_max = int(bbox[2] / 1000.0 * img_height) x_max = int(bbox[3] / 1000.0 * img_width) bbox_w = x_max - x_min bbox_h = y_max - y_min # Draw the normalized bounding box top_left = (x_min, y_min) bottom_right = (x_max, y_max) cv2.rectangle(image, top_left, bottom_right, color=(0, 255, 0), thickness=2) # Save the image cv2.imwrite(output_path, image) print(f"Image with normalized bounding box saved as {output_path}")
